    You would be surprised at mileage. When I was still working we had a customer with one of those. Built on Ford 550 chassis with Cummins diesel. Normal driving about 15/16. Towing 28 to 35 foot boats around 10/11. Tires are what eat you up.

    No that is not it. Its this one he can take a nap at the ramp or get there late and sleep where hes the first at the ramp. 1987 Ford F800 with 10 Speed trans and 60" Stand-up sleeper. Air ride on back along with air ride seats. Ford 7.8 I-6 Diesel motor and 24.5 Wheels and tires.
